§ 20945. Office of Sex Offender Sentencing, Monitoring, Apprehending, Registering, and Tracking
(a) Establishment
(b) Director
(c) Duties and functions
The SMART Office is authorized to—
(1) administer the standards for the sex offender registration and notification program set forth in this chapter;
(2) administer grant programs relating to sex offender registration and notification authorized by this chapter and other grant programs authorized by this chapter as directed by the Attorney General;
(3) cooperate with and provide technical assistance to States, units of local government, tribal governments, and other public and private entities involved in activities related to sex offender registration or notification or to other measures for the protection of children or other members of the public from sexual abuse or exploitation; and
(4) perform such other functions as the Attorney General may delegate.
